The Claim
Clonal hematopoiesis of indeterminate potential (CHIP) may be associated with systemic inflammation and altered red blood cell turnover, which could contribute to discordant HbA1c values in individuals who do not have anemia or hemoglobinopathy.

1 studyThe study looks at a woman with a blood condition called CHIP and finds her blood sugar test (HbA1c) was normal even though her actual sugar levels were high. Doctors think CHIP may have changed how her red blood cells worked, making the test misleading.
